Bridge Snapshot: WHITON CROSSING RD

The WHITON CROSSING RD bridge in Worcester, Maryland carries WHITON CROSSING RD over POCOMOKE RIVER. It was built in 1996, making it 30 years old today. The structure is built primarily of wood or timber and spans 6 sections, stretching 31.4 meters (103 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 138 vehicles, placing it in the lower-traffic tier of Maryland bridges. It is owned and maintained by County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 6/9, superstructure at 6/9, substructure at 7/9. The weakest component sits in fair condition. All reported major components score above the Poor range. Its NBI inventory load rating is 38.5 metric tons.

Condition Analysis

  • The deck (driving surface) is in fair condition (6/9), with minor deterioration that may require routine maintenance.
  • The superstructure (beams and supports above the deck) rates fair at 6/9, minor deterioration that routine maintenance should address.
  • The substructure (piers and abutments) is in good condition (7/9), showing no significant deterioration.
